Which mechanism sustains increased drag on aircraft wings during turbulent atmospheric conditions?

A)Momentum diffusion by eddy viscosity
B)Decreased pressure normal shockwaves
C)Increased laminar boundary layer adhesion
D)Improved adverse pressure compensation

💡 Explanation

Momentum diffusion by eddy viscosity increases drag because turbulent eddies mix high and low momentum air, slowing airflow near the wing's surface. Therefore, more drag results, rather than improved lift or pressure gradients possible in laminar flow.
